【摘要】:电力与信息的深度融合是能源互联网发展研究趋势,文中主要针对电力信息融合趋势下的风险传递现象进行综述与展望。首先,对电力与信息融合的发展趋势分阶段进行了分析,研究了能源互联网阶段的电力与信息交互模式。在此基础上,从信息风险传递和电力与信息风险交互两个方面分析了电力与信息风险传递研究现状。最后,对能源互联网下的电力信息融合网络结构从拓扑和运行层面进行分析,提出了能源互联网下电力信息风险传递前瞻性课题研究思路,借鉴风险元理论建立了研究该问题的三维框架。
[Abstract]:The deep integration of power and information is the trend of the development of energy Internet. This paper reviews and prospects the risk transmission phenomenon in the trend of power information fusion. Firstly, the development trend of electric power and information fusion is analyzed in stages, and the interactive mode of power and information in the stage of energy Internet is studied. On this basis, the present situation of research on power and information risk transmission is analyzed from the aspects of information risk transmission and the interaction of power and information risk. Finally, the network structure of power information fusion under the energy Internet is analyzed from the topology and operation level, and the prospective research ideas of power information risk transmission under the energy Internet are put forward. Based on the risk element theory, a three-dimensional framework is established to study this problem.
